Abstract

We demonstrate the feasibility of spectrum defragmentation in a flexible-grid optical network utilizing the flexible transmitter and receiver. According to the defragmentation controller, the flexible transmitter dynamically switches the modulation format/symbol rate/wavelength without hardware modification.
